A few of my customers have decided on the Non Irrigated sands near Coldwater, Michigan that a shorter season hybrid planted early, may be the better choice for maturity than something that is a fuller season hybrid. The longer season corns were just getting hammered by the July/August dry season. The shorter season hybrids planted early were actually escaping the dry period to a point in order to finish before it was as heavily influenced by the dry period.

Save all the moisture you can.
